The Recruitment Crowd are currently recruiting on behalf of our industry-leading parcel courier client based in the Leeds (LS9) area. This is an excellent opportunity to join a fast-paced, growing operation with long-term prospects.

Location: Leeds (LS9)

Shift Pattern: Night shifts, 10:00pm - 6:00am

Pay Rate: From £12.71 per hour (PAYE)

Job Type: Ongoing role with the opportunity for a permanent position for the right candidate

About the Role

As a Parcel Sorter, you will play a key role in ensuring parcels are processed accurately and efficiently to meet delivery deadlines. This is a hands-on role within a busy warehouse environ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Accurately sort and organise incoming parcels by route and destination
  • Operate conveyor belts, scanners, and other warehouse equipment
  • Ensure parcels are correctly labelled and categorised
  • Work closely with team members to maintain smooth workflow and meet deadlines
  • Identify damaged parcels and follow company procedures for reporting and handling
  • Assist with loading and unloading delivery vehicles, maximising space efficiency
  • Maintain a clean, safe, and organised work environment
  • Follow all company health, safety, and security policies

What We're Looking For

  • Previous experience in a warehouse, logistics, or parcel sorting role is desirable but not essential
  • Ability to stand for long periods and lift parcels of varying weights
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y
  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ced environment
  • Reliable, punctual, and a strong team player
  • Flexibility to work night shifts and occasional overtime
  • Own transport or reliable means of getting to site
